Output c11994e4c2f6f9d7c23b0c4d5c4dcef32c41de4de8d30b6c027e0ef9718bd91a:2

value
26332686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b432b1661cbb75ca3be045ba5480751344c28623 OP_EQUAL
address
3J7pHHKNr3JY8GNxfZNKucjR4D93ynU8cV
transaction
c11994e4c2f6f9d7c23b0c4d5c4dcef32c41de4de8d30b6c027e0ef9718bd91a
confirmations
157726
spent
true